I've been able to get it working with Windows 10 and Ableton 9.5 after no small amount of trouble. Here's what has worked for me:
Connect your Minitaur with both usb midi and usb to midi din.
Open Ableton preferences, and, under the midi tab, choose "usb 2.0 midi"(your midi din connection) as an in and out in the control surfaces section. Highlight "track" in and out for usb 2.0 midi. Do not do anything with the mood minitaur option. Leave it open for the the editor.
Drop an "external instrument" device into a midi track. Choose "usb 2.0 midi" as "midi in".
-Now drop in the audio device version of the editor. You should be good to go. Recording automation is possible through the sliders on the docked portion of the plugin.
